2014 Polo BlueGT clutch pedal creak - ongoing issue.
Posted: Fri Jan 03, 2020 9:20 pm
As my car is still under warranty, I took it back to the main dealer which I bought it from and explained the issue to them. Long story short, the technician simply put some high-temperature grease in the clutch pedal assembly, only for the noise to reoccur.
Took my car back yesterday for the same issue, again, a technician applied some grease and this time bled the clutch and yet again, the creak still remains. I got told on the job sheet that and I quote "May need 4 hours strip down to assess clutch".
Now, I'm not saying that they're simply trying to get some money out of me, however, I feel there could be another cause for this noise, as in a bad clutch slave cylinder? Opinions? Should I take my car to an independent garage or is their an easy fix?
